Acalypha indica (English: Indian Acalypha, Indian Mercury, Indian Copperleaf, Indian Nettle, Three-seeded Mercury) is an herbaceous annual that has catkin-like inflorescences with cup-shaped involucres surrounding the minute flowers. The plant has also been eaten as a vegetable in Africa and India, but care needs when eating it since it contains several alkaloids as well as hydrocyanic acid. Acalypha indica distributed in the southern part of India particularly in Tamilnadu and it has potential medicinal properties and used as diuretic, anthelmintic and for respiratory problems such as bronchitis, asthma and pneumonia. Acalypha indica in Ayurveda.7 Preparations - Infusion of root, powder, decoction, cataplasm, succus (juice expressed), tincture and liquid extract.
